Output fd399393e42564b62f0cbc74fb37f2e05a2c9f12bee2ba548a30fbb51978d2fa:0

value
32769
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4858c4a1988bf12c5a482e6e29a1e92fe028ea85 OP_EQUAL
address
38HYv53ouxRaZZAuzNu2x2B5qiueQAAy9e
transaction
fd399393e42564b62f0cbc74fb37f2e05a2c9f12bee2ba548a30fbb51978d2fa
confirmations
37904
spent
true